Output 24a1250b68be9f570d661bf33df82cd5d7f8ce8c8fa5517fdf1bd892d6188221:27

value
632928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d57748a98dedaaaa4e50b58499717576e9e4f4ee OP_EQUAL
address
3M9ikPa1Zf7k7cCiMGxWw4hRBwbiFA4d5j
transaction
24a1250b68be9f570d661bf33df82cd5d7f8ce8c8fa5517fdf1bd892d6188221
spent
true